+Convert SageNB Notebooks
+========================
+
+This is a tool to convert SageNB notebooks to other formats, in
+particular IPython/Jupyter notebooks.
+
+
+Install
+-------
+
+ pip install git+https://github.com/vbraun/ExportSageNB.git
+
+or
+
+ sage -pip install git+https://github.com/vbraun/ExportSageNB.git
+
+
+Usage
+-----
+
+First, you want to list the existing notebooks. Each notebook has a
+unique id and a not necessarily unique name:
+
+ $ sagenb-export --list
+ Unique ID | Notebook Name
+ -------------------------------------------------------------------------------
+ admin:10 | Oxford Seminar (1,1)-Calabi Yau
+
+You can specify notebooks by the ID or by name; If the name is not
+unique, the first notebook found in the filesystem wins. To convert it
+to a Jupyter/IPython notebook, use the `--ipynb` switch as in
+
+ $ sagenb-export --ipynb=Output.ipynb admin:10
+
+You can then open the saved `Output.ipynb` via
+
+ $ sage --notebook=jupyter Output.ipynb
+
+
+Notes
+-----
+
+* Various output formats are not supported, e.g. no pictures. The
+ simplest solution is to re-evaluate.
+
+* SageNB html input cells are converted to Jupyter raw NBConvert
+ cells; In the interactive Jupyter notebook these are not rendered as
+ html but shown as their html source code. If you export to HTML
+ (File -> Download as -> HTML) they are rendered as html, though.
+
+
+Testing and Python Compatibility
+--------------------------------
+
+* The git-trac command supports Python 2.7, and 3.4+.

+
+import os
+import re
+
+try:
+ # Python 2
+ import cPickle as pickle
+except ImportError:
+ # Python 3
+ import pickle
+
+from sagenb_export.logger import log
+from sagenb_export.unescape import unescape
+
+
+CELL_FRONT = re.compile(u'^\{\{\{id=(?P<index>[0-9]*)\|$')
+CELL_MID = re.compile(u'^///$')
+CELL_BACK = re.compile(u'^\}\}\}$')
+
+
+
+class Cell(object):
+
+ def __init__(self, input):
+ self.input = input
+
+ def __repr__(self):
+ return '{0}:"{1}"'.format(type(self), self.input.encode('utf-8', 'replace'))
+
+class ComputeCell(Cell):
+
+ def __init__(self, index, input, output):
+ assert index >= 0
+ super(ComputeCell, self).__init__(input)
+ self.index = index
+ self.output = output
+
+
+class TextCell(Cell):
+ pass
+
+
+
+class WorksheetParser(object):
+
+ def __init__(self, worksheet_html):
+ self.worksheet_lines = worksheet_html.splitlines()
+ self.pos = 0
+ self.index = -1
+ log.debug('Worksheet has %s lines', len(self.worksheet_lines))
+
+ @property
+ def line(self):
+ return self.worksheet_lines[self.pos]
+
+ def get_line_and_forward(self):
+ line = self.line
+ self.pos += 1
+ return line
+
+ @property
+ def is_finished(self):
+ return self.pos >= len(self.worksheet_lines)
+
+ @property
+ def is_cell_front(self):
+ match = CELL_FRONT.match(self.line)
+ if match:
+ self.index = int(match.group('index'))
+ return True
+ else:
+ return False
+
+ @property
+ def is_cell_mid(self):
+ match = CELL_MID.match(self.line)
+ return match != None
+
+ @property
+ def is_cell_back(self):
+ match = CELL_BACK.match(self.line)
+ return match != None
+
+ def _try_read_text(self):
+ accumulator = []
+ while not (self.is_cell_front or self.is_finished):
+ log.debug('Read text: %s', self.line)
+ accumulator.append(self.get_line_and_forward())
+ accumulator = u'\n'.join(accumulator).strip()
+ if accumulator:
+ return TextCell(unescape(accumulator))
+
+ def _read_cell_input(self):
+ assert self.is_cell_front
+ self.pos += 1
+ accumulator = []
+ while not (self.is_cell_mid or self.is_finished):
+ log.debug('Read cell input: %s', self.line)
+ accumulator.append(self.get_line_and_forward())
+ return unescape(u'\n'.join(accumulator).strip())
+
+ def _read_cell_output(self):
+ assert self.is_cell_mid
+ self.pos += 1
+ accumulator = []
+ while not (self.is_cell_back or self.is_finished):
+ log.debug('Read cell output: %s', self.line)
+ accumulator.append(self.get_line_and_forward())
+ return unescape(u'\n'.join(accumulator).strip())
+
+ def _read_cell(self):
+ input = self._read_cell_input()
+ output = self._read_cell_output()
+ return ComputeCell(self.index, input, output)
+
+ def __iter__(self):
+ while not self.is_finished:
+ text = self._try_read_text()
+ if text:
+ yield text
+ yield self._read_cell()
+ if not self.is_finished:
+ assert self.is_cell_back
+ self.pos += 1
+
+
+
+class NotebookSageNB(object):
+
+ def __init__(self, path):
+ log.debug('opening notebook root directory: %s', path)
+ self.path = path
+ with open(os.path.join(path, 'worksheet.html'), 'rb') as f:
+ self.ws = f.read().decode('utf-8')
+ with open(os.path.join(path, 'worksheet_conf.pickle'), 'rb') as f:
+ self.conf = pickle.load(f)
+
+ def __repr__(self):
+ return '{0}:"{1}"'.format(self.unique_id, self.name.encode('utf-8', 'replace'))
+
+ @classmethod
+ def all_iter(cls, dot_sage):
+ store = os.path.join(dot_sage, 'sage_notebook.sagenb', 'home', '__store__')
+ for path, dirs, files in os.walk(store):
+ worksheet = os.path.join(path, 'worksheet.html')
+ if os.path.isfile(worksheet):
+ yield cls(path)
+
+ @classmethod
+ def find(cls, dot_sage, name_or_unique_id):
+ for notebook in cls.all_iter(dot_sage):
+ if notebook.unique_id == name_or_unique_id:
+ return notebook
+ if notebook.name == name_or_unique_id:
+ return notebook
+ raise ValueError('no such notebook: {0}'.format(name_or_unique_id))
+
+ @property
+ def sort_key(self):
+ return (self.conf['owner'], self.conf['id_number'])
+
+ def __lt__(lhs, rhs):
+ return lhs.sort_key < rhs.sort_key
+
+ @property
+ def unique_id(self):
+ return '{0}:{1}'.format(self.conf['owner'], self.conf['id_number'])
+
+ @property
+ def name(self):
+ return self.conf['name']
+
+ @property
+ def cells(self):
+ for cell in WorksheetParser(self.ws):
+ log.debug('Cell: %s', cell)
+ yield cell
+

+
+
+<h1 style="text-align: center;">The 24-Cell</h1>
+
+{{{id=4|
+cell24 = polytopes.twenty_four_cell()
+cell24.f_vector() # it is self-dual
+///
+(1, 24, 96, 96, 24, 1)
+}}}
+
+{{{id=86|
+cell24.f_vector?
+///
+<html><!--notruncate-->
+
+<div class="docstring">
+
+ <p><strong>File:</strong> /home/vbraun/Sage/sage/local/lib/python2.6/site-packages/sage/geometry/polyhedra.py</p>
+<p><strong>Type:</strong> <type ‘instancemethod’></p>
+<p><strong>Definition:</strong> cell24.f_vector()</p>
+<p><strong>Docstring:</strong></p>
+<blockquote>
+<p>Return the f-vector.</p>
+<p>OUTPUT:</p>
+<p>Returns a vector whose <tt class="docutils literal"><span class="pre">i</span></tt>-th entry is the number of
+<tt class="docutils literal"><span class="pre">i</span></tt>-dimensional faces of the polytope.</p>
+<p>EXAMPLES:</p>
+<div class="highlight-python"><div class="highlight"><pre class="literal-block"><span class="gp">sage: </span><span class="n">p</span> <span class="o">=</span> <span class="n">Polyhedron</span><span class="p">(</span><span class="n">vertices</span> <span class="o">=</span> <span class="p">[[</span><span class="mi">1</span><span class="p">,</span> <span class="mi">2</span><span class="p">,</span> <span class="mi">3</span><span class="p">],</span> <span class="p">[</span><span class="mi">1 [...]
+<span class="gp">sage: </span><span class="n">p</span><span class="o">.</span><span class="n">f_vector</span><span class="p">()</span>
+<span class="go">(1, 7, 12, 7, 1)</span>
+</pre></div>
+</div>
+</blockquote>
+
+
+</div>
+</html>
+}}}
+
+<p>Here is a picture of the 24-cell projected into 3 dimensions:</p>
+
+{{{id=1|
+cell24.plot()
+///
+}}}
+
+<p><span style="font-weight: normal;"><span style="font-size: medium;">The "round" 24-cell can be $GL(4,\mathbb{Q})$-squished into a lattice polytope:</span></span></p>
+
+{{{id=13|
+cell24 = Polyhedron(vertices=[
+ (1,0,0,0),(0,1,0,0),(0,0,1,0),(0,0,0,1),(1,-1,-1,1),(0,0,-1,1),
+ (0,-1,0,1),(-1,0,0,1),(1,0,0,-1),(0,1,0,-1),(0,0,1,-1),(-1,1,1,-1),
+ (1,-1,-1,0),(0,0,-1,0),(0,-1,0,0),(-1,0,0,0),(1,-1,0,0),(1,0,-1,0),
+ (0,1,1,-1),(-1,1,1,0),(-1,1,0,0),(-1,0,1,0),(0,-1,-1,1),(0,0,0,-1)])
+cell24.f_vector()
+///
+(1, 24, 96, 96, 24, 1)
+}}}
+
+{{{id=67|
+cell24.lattice_polytope().is_reflexive()
+///
+True
+}}}
+
+<h2>Symmetry groups</h2>
+<p>Here is the symmetry group of the 24-cell</p>
+
+{{{id=27|
+Aut = cell24.restricted_automorphism_group()
+Aut.cardinality()
+///
+1152
+}}}
+
+{{{id=34|
+Aut.gens()
+///
+[(3,9)(4,18)(7,13)(8,14)(10,20)(22,24), (2,3)(6,7)(10,11)(14,15)(17,18)(21,22), (2,4)(3,19)(5,18)(7,10)(8,21)(9,17)(12,22)(14,23)(15,24), (2,18)(3,17)(4,5)(8,23)(9,19)(12,24)(13,20)(14,21)(15,22), (2,19)(3,4)(5,17)(6,11)(8,22)(9,18)(12,21)(14,24)(15,23), (1,2,19,10,12,24,16,15,23,7,5,4)(3,18,20,9,21,11,14,22,13,8,17,6), (1,16)(2,21)(3,22)(4,8)(5,23)(9,24)(12,19)(14,18)(15,17)]
+}}}
+
+<p>Pick the following $G$-permutation action on the vertices of $\nabla$</p>
+
+{{{id=36|
+G = PermutationGroup([
+ '(1,14,22)(2,24,7)(3,18,16)(4,10,15)(5,21,11)(6,12,17)(8,19,13)(9,23,20)',
+ '(1,10,16,7)(2,12,15,5)(3,9,14,8)(4,19,24,23)(6,20,11,13)(17,18,21,22)'])
+G.is_subgroup(Aut) and G.is_isomorphic( SL(2,3).as_matrix_group().as_permutation_group() )
+///
+True
+}}}
+
+{{{id=85|
+G.orbits()
+///
+[[1, 10, 14, 16, 15, 8, 22, 7, 3, 5, 4, 19, 17, 2, 9, 18, 21, 24, 13, 6, 12, 23, 11, 20]]
+}}}
+
+<p>Representatives for the 7 conjugacy classes:</p>
+
+{{{id=44|
+G.conjugacy_classes_representatives()
+///
+[(), (1,2,21,16,15,17)(3,19,10,14,23,7)(4,20,12,24,13,5)(6,8,22,11,9,18), (1,4,8,16,24,9)(2,6,23,15,11,19)(3,20,21,14,13,17)(5,7,22,12,10,18), (1,6,16,11)(2,14,15,3)(4,21,24,17)(5,8,12,9)(7,20,10,13)(18,23,22,19), (1,8,24)(2,23,11)(3,21,13)(4,16,9)(5,22,10)(6,15,19)(7,12,18)(14,17,20), (1,16)(2,15)(3,14)(4,24)(5,12)(6,11)(7,10)(8,9)(13,20)(17,21)(18,22)(19,23), (1,21,15)(2,16,17)(3,10,23)(4,12,13)(5,20,24)(6,22,9)(7,19,14)(8,11,18)]
+}}}
+
+<p>Here is the orbit of $1$ under the permutation $g_3$:</p>
+
+{{{id=52|
+(G.1).orbit(1)
+///
+[1, 14, 22]
+}}}
+
+<h1 style="text-align: center;">The 24-cell toric variety</h1>
+
+{{{id=45|
+fan = FaceFan(cell24.lattice_polytope())
+Pnabla = ToricVariety(FaceFan(cell24.lattice_polytope()),
+ coordinate_names='z1, z2, z3, z4, z5, z6, z7, z8, z9, z10, z11, z12, '+
+ 'z13, z14, z15, z16, z17, z18, z19, z20, z21, z22, z23, z24',
+ base_field=GF(101))
+Pnabla
+///
+4-d toric variety covered by 24 affine patches
+}}}
+
+{{{id=56|
+Pnabla.Chow_group().degree()
+///
+(Z, Z, C2 x C2 x Z^30, Z^20, Z)
+}}}
+
+{{{id=54|
+SR = Pnabla.Stanley_Reisner_ideal(); SR
+///
+Ideal (z2*z11, z4*z11, z5*z11, z6*z11, z8*z11, z11*z14, z11*z18, z11*z21, z11*z23, z1*z12, z4*z12, z5*z12, z6*z12, z7*z12, z12*z13, z12*z17, z12*z18, z12*z23, z1*z15, z2*z15, z4*z15, z6*z15, z10*z15, z15*z18, z15*z19, z15*z20, z15*z21, z1*z16, z2*z16, z3*z16, z4*z16, z5*z16, z9*z16, z16*z17, z16*z18, z16*z19, z1*z22, z2*z22, z5*z22, z6*z22, z9*z22, z10*z22, z13*z22, z14*z22, z18*z22, z1*z24, z2*z24, z3*z24, z4*z24, z5*z24, z6*z24, z7*z24, z8*z24, z20*z24, z3*z10, z4*z10, z5*z10, z7*z10, [...]
+}}}
+
+{{{id=55|
+Pnabla.inject_variables()
+z1*z16 in SR and z1*z14*z22 in SR
+///
+Defining z1, z2, z3, z4, z5, z6, z7, z8, z9, z10, z11, z12, z13, z14, z15, z16, z17, z18, z19, z20, z21, z22, z23, z24
+True
+}}}
+
+<h1 style="text-align: center;">The Calabi-Yau Hypersurface</h1>
+<p style="text-align: left;">The polynomial $P=P_0+P_\infty$ is</p>
+
+{{{id=57|
+anticanonical_bundle = -Pnabla.K()
+P = sum(anticanonical_bundle.sections_monomials())
+P([1]*24) # g_3 and g_4^2-fixed point z_i=1
+///
+25
+}}}
+
+<p>One of the maximal cones is $\langle p_1,p_2,p_3,p_4,p_{19},p_{20}\rangle$:</p>
+
+{{{id=69|
+cone = fan.generating_cone(8)
+cone.ambient_ray_indices()
+///
+(0, 1, 2, 3, 18, 19)
+}}}
+
+<p>The singularity of $\mathbb{P}_\nabla$ is where the corresponding homogeneous variables vanish:</p>
+
+{{{id=63|
+P(0,0,0,0,1,1,1,1,1,1,1,1,1,1,1,1,1,1,0,0,1,1,1,1)
+///
+1
+}}}
+
+<h1 style="text-align: center;">Checking Transversality of the Equation</h1>
+<p><span style="font-weight: normal;"><span style="font-size: medium;">The patches are non-complete intersections: 9 equations in $\mathbb{C}^8$ cutting out a $4$-dimensional affine toric variety</span></span></p>
+
+{{{id=71|
+ambient_patch = Pnabla.affine_algebraic_patch(cone, names='x+')
+ambient_patch
+///
+Closed subscheme of Affine Space of dimension 8 over Finite Field of size 101 defined by:
+ -x1*x4 + x0*x7,
+ -x1*x5 + x0*x6,
+ -x4*x6 + x5*x7,
+ x0*x4 - x3*x5,
+ -x2*x4 + x3*x7,
+ -x1*x4 + x3*x6,
+ x0*x2 - x1*x3,
+ x2*x6 - x1*x7,
+ -x1*x4 + x2*x5
+}}}
+
+<p>Of course there is a singularity at $0\in \mathbb{C}^8$:</p>
+
+{{{id=76|
+ambient_patch.is_smooth()
+///
+False
+}}}
+
+<p>Now we throw in the equation $P=0$ and go to the same patch again:</p>
+
+{{{id=70|
+Xtilde = Pnabla.subscheme(P)
+patch = Xtilde.affine_algebraic_patch(cone, names='x+')
+patch
+///
+Closed subscheme of Affine Space of dimension 8 over Finite Field of size 101 defined by:
+ -x1*x4 + x0*x7,
+ -x1*x5 + x0*x6,
+ -x4*x6 + x5*x7,
+ x0*x4 - x3*x5,
+ -x2*x4 + x3*x7,
+ -x1*x4 + x3*x6,
+ x0*x2 - x1*x3,
+ x2*x6 - x1*x7,
+ -x1*x4 + x2*x5,
+ x2^2*x5^2 + x0*x2*x5 + x2^2*x5 + x2*x3*x5 + x2*x4*x5 + x2*x5^2 + x0*x2*x6 + x2*x5*x6 + x2*x5*x7 + x0*x2 + x0*x4 + x2*x4 + x1*x5 + x2*x5 + x2*x6 + x5*x7 + x0 + x1 + x2 + x3 + x4 + x5 + x6 + x7 + 1
+}}}
+
+{{{id=73|
+patch.is_smooth()
+///
+True
+}}}
+
+{{{id=81|
+
+///
+}}}
